Objektorienterad design OOD - Teknologi - 2021 - continuousdev

5269

Vad är objektorienterad design? - Netinbag

• Objektorienterad analys: studera krav på systemet (t.ex. från användarfall) och modellera den relevanta delen av världen i form av objekt och relationer mellan dessa. • Objektorienterad design: strukturera program i klasser och beskriv hur dessa är relaterade (arv, association, mönster, …). Objektorienterad modellering och design Aktuellt Kursen kommer under hösten 2020 att ges på distans, med föreläsningar, seminarier och handledningsmöten på Zoom.

  1. Josefin lehto kiruna
  2. Kontracyklisk finanspolitik nackdelar
  3. Europaskolan strangnas
  4. Facebook tävlingar
  5. Vattenfall hr direct
  6. Eivy redwood sherpa jacket

Översikt. Logga in You will know how an object oriented design model can be translated in to an object oriented implementation (code) and vice verse (reverse engineering). You will have basic understanding of design patterns and refactoring as a method to achieve a good design. Objektorienterad analys och design (OOA&D) med CRC-kort, som beskrivs här, har dock visat sig fungera bra i många sammanhang. Detta är tänkt att vara en introduktion till objektorienterad analys och design och beskriver ett förfarande som innehåller följande delar: Objektorienterad analys (OOA): målet är att förstå problemet och att bygga en objektorienterad modell av problemområdet. Kursen innehåller momenten:Principer och metoder för objektorienterad analys och domänmodellering i UMLPrinciper och metoder för objektorienterad design i UMLPrinciper och metoder för användandet av designmönsterTransformation av objektorienterad design till objektorienterad implementation och vice versaPrinciper och metoder för refactoring av objektorienterad implementation som metod för objektorienterad design • Objektorienterad analys: studera krav på systemet (t.ex. från användarfall) och modellera den relevanta delen av världen i form av objekt och relationer mellan dessa.

Objektorienterad design är processen att planera ett  av E Eklund · 2001 — Vid objektorienterad systemutveckling bör programmeringsfasen föregås av analys och design. Detta för att se till att systemet uppfyller kundernas krav samt  Jag har: class c1 { struct data1; void c1_function(){ // instantiate class c2 and do some computation with c2"s member function and // struct data1 } }. Jag har en  Denna kurs behandlar objektorienterad programmering i C# och objektorienterad design för Windowsapplikationer.

objektorienterad design med c ++ [stängd] - c ++, objekt, design

Designa och implementera objektorienterade program för en given domän på ett sunt sätt med avseende på korrekthet, modifierbarhet och återanvändbarhet. Utföra och beskriva testning av objektorienterade … Häftad, 2001.

Informatik, Objektorienterad analys och design

Objektorienterad design

Logga in You will know how an object oriented design model can be translated in to an object oriented implementation (code) and vice verse (reverse engineering).

Understand the concepts and principles of object ­oriented analysis and design. Be able to develop object ­oriented models in UML for different problems. Be able to transform object oriented models into an object ­oriented programming language and vice versa. Have basic knowledge of the use of design … Moment 2 (objektorienterad analys, design och implementation) examineras via ett antal obligatoriska uppgifter.
Kapitalgruppen omdöme

Objektorienterad design

Föreläsningar, laborationer och projektarbete. Särskild behörighet. En grundkurs i programmering på 7,5 hp. Examination.

Klassbegreppet i programmering. Objektorienterad design, Utbyggnad av objektmodellen. Att namnge och  om man lyckas bygga en sk soa lösning utan en objekt orienterad design i botten är med stor sannolikhet ute och cyklar på djupt vatten :) Svara  Uppgift:Vilket påstående om en objektorienterad design stämmer bäst?a. Hög kohesion medför ofta hög koppling.b. Hög kohesion medför ofta  2) Vilket av följande påståenden om GRASP designprinciperna är sant? (1 p) a) Låg koppling (low coupling) går ut på att objekt av en klass inte  Granlund specialises in software services, consultancy and design. Java är ett objektorienterat programmeringsspråk vars syfte är att vara så oberoende som  Objektorienterad design (Object-oriented design): Ett modulärt tillvägagångssätt för systemdesign där funktioner grupperas logiskt tillsammans med deras  Kursen bygger vidare på Objektorienterad design och programmering och ger fördjupade teoretiska och praktiska kunskaper.
Järva tolk arvode

För att få mer information om utbildningen Objektorienterad design och programmering från Högskolan i Gävle, fyll i dina uppgifter: Hoppa över till innehåll. Översikt. Logga in You will know how an object oriented design model can be translated in to an object oriented implementation (code) and vice verse (reverse engineering). You will have basic understanding of design patterns and refactoring as a method to achieve a good design. Objektorienterad analys och design (OOA&D) med CRC-kort, som beskrivs här, har dock visat sig fungera bra i många sammanhang. Detta är tänkt att vara en introduktion till objektorienterad analys och design och beskriver ett förfarande som innehåller följande delar: Objektorienterad analys (OOA): målet är att förstå problemet och att bygga en objektorienterad modell av problemområdet.

• Objektorienterad design: strukturera program i klasser och beskriv hur dessa är relaterade (arv, association, mönster, …).
Skilt sig

räkna ut din sysselsättningsgrad
norrskenet skola boden
barn som far illa
olika utvecklingspsykologiska teorier
ljusdal bandyarena
orkelljunga sverige
skatteverket postadress linköping

Objektorienterad mjukvaruutveckling med designmönster 7,5 hp

Denna sida på svenska This page in English. Aktuellt. Kursen kommer under hösten 2020 att ges på  Kursen benämns Objektorienterad Design /.